在当前互联网时代,网站的数据迁移和数据备份是维护网站长期稳定性的重要工作之一,DedeCMS作为一款流行的内容管理系统,提供了相对简便的方式来帮助用户完成数据迁移,下面将详细解释如何搬迁DedeCMS站点数据的整个过程:
1、准备工作
备份数据:登录到DedeCMS后台,进入“系统》数据库备份/还原”栏目,全选所有数据库表进行备份,这一步骤是确保在迁移过程中,即使出现错误,也能通过备份恢复数据。
重命名备份文件夹:如果系统中已存在备份,应将织梦程序根目录下的data文件夹下的backupdata文件夹重命名为其他名称,如"_backupdata",以避免在备份过程中产生冲突。
确认数据库信息:获取目的地服务器的数据库账号和密码,并确保有创建数据库的权限或已存在一个数据库以供使用。
2、备份上传
备份文件上传:备份成功后,需要将所有程序及目录上传到新的服务器,应当将已上传程序的install目录下的“index.php.bak”改名为“index.php”,并将“moduleinstall.php.bak”更改为“moduleinstall.php”,删除“install_lock.txt”文件,这些操作确保了在新服务器上DedeCMS能够正常安装和运行。
3、数据传输
FTP工具:使用FTP客户端工具链接到原空间和新空间,通过FTP进行数据传输,这一过程涉及将备份的数据库表从原空间传输到新的FTP空间,实现数据的物理迁移。
4、数据库迁移
导入数据库表:在新服务器上,首先需要将备份的数据库表导入到相应的数据库中,这可以通过DedeCMS的数据库备份/还原功能来完成,或者直接通过数据库管理工具如phpMyAdmin等来进行导入操作。
5、配置新服务器
修改配置文件:迁移完成后,通常需要修改DedeCMS中数据库配置文件(如config.php等),更新数据库名、用户名和密码等信息,确保网站能够正确连接到新服务器上的数据库。
6、测试与验证
全面测试:数据迁移完成后,务必进行全面的测试,包括前台页面的访问、后台管理功能的正常使用以及数据的完整性检查,确保所有功能均能正常运行。
尽管上述步骤为DedeCMS站点数据迁移提供了一套较为通用的指南,但在实际操作过程中,依然可能遇到一些特殊情况,在表格中,将补充一些注意事项和常见问题的解决策略:
注意事项 | 解决策略 |
保持备份的习惯性 | 定期对数据库和网站文件进行备份,避免数据丢失。 |
兼容性检查 | 确认新服务器的环境是否与原服务器一致,特别是PHP版本和数据库版本。 |
文件权限 | 确保所有文件上传后,文件权限正确,避免因权限问题导致网站功能异常。 |
暂时关闭外链图片等媒体文件的自动加载 | 避免在数据迁移过程中,因外部链接失效导致页面显示问题。 |
清除浏览器缓存 | 在测试过程中清除浏览器缓存,确保每次访问都是服务器最新的内容。 |
在完成DedeCMS站点数据迁移的整个过程中,不仅需要按照步骤操作,还要留意各种可能的细节问题,通过备份、传输、导入、配置和测试这一系列环节,加上对可能出现的问题有所准备,可以有效地完成数据迁移任务,定期备份和合理规划迁移时间也是保证数据安全和减少用户影响的重要措施。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/943116.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复